#97654f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#97654f is composed of 59.2% red, 39.6%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 33.1% magenta, 47.7%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 18.3 degrees, a saturation of 31.3% and a lightness of 45.1%. #97654f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ffca9e with #2f0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

Shades and Tints of #97654f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090605 is the darkest color, while #fdfc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#97654f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#747372 is the less saturated color, while #de4908 is the most saturated one.
